paternity testing, also known as DNA testing, involves analyzing the genetic material of an individual to determine if they are the biological father of a child. This process is usually done through a simple buccal swab, where cells from the inside of the cheek are collected and sent to a laboratory for analysis. The results of the test can provide a probability of paternity ranging from 99.9% to 0%, giving a clear indication of the likelihood of biological relatedness.

One of the main reasons why paternity testing is so important is for legal purposes. In cases where child support, custody, or visitation rights are being disputed, having conclusive evidence of paternity can make a significant impact on the outcome of a court case. It ensures that the rights and responsibilities of both the father and the child are accurately determined, leading to fair and just decisions.

With advancements in technology, paternity testing has become more accessible and accurate than ever before. In the past, blood tests were commonly used for paternity testing, but today, DNA testing is the gold standard due to its high level of accuracy and reliability. DNA testing compares genetic markers between the alleged father and child to determine the likelihood of paternity, providing results with an unparalleled level of certainty.
